How much do commodity trading operations j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 14, 2026, the average yearly pay for commodity trading operations in the United States is $98,041.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$80,000.00 and $114,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a commodity trading operations professional?

To thrive in Commodity Trading Operations, you need strong analytical abilities, attention to detail, and a background in finance, business, or supply chain management. Familiarity with trading platforms, risk management systems, and industry-standard software like Excel or SAP is typically required. Outstanding organizational skills, effective communication, and the ability to work under pressure help professionals excel in this dynamic environment. These competencies are crucial for ensuring smooth trade execution, mitigating risks, and maintaining regulatory compliance in fast-paced markets.

What are some common challenges faced in commodity trading operations, and how can they be managed effectively?

Professionals in commodity trading operations often encounter challenges such as managing complex logistics, ensuring compliance with evolving regulations, and handling the volatility of global markets. Coordinating shipment schedules, accurate documentation, and timely communication across multiple stakeholders are crucial to avoid costly delays or errors. Adopting robust risk management practices, staying updated on industry regulations, and leveraging technology for real-time tracking and reporting can help mitigate these challenges and maintain smooth operations.

What is the difference between Commodity Trading Operations vs Commodity Trading Analyst?

AspectCommodity Trading OperationsCommodity Trading Analyst
Primary RoleManage trade execution, logistics, and settlement processesAnalyze market data, develop trading strategies, and forecast prices
Required SkillsOperational knowledge, attention to detail, understanding of trading systemsAnalytical skills, market research, financial modeling
CertificationsTypically none required, but certifications like FMC or CTP can helpOften requires finance or economics degrees, certifications like CFA beneficial
Work EnvironmentFast-paced trading floors, back-office operationsResearch departments, trading desks, financial analysis teams

While Commodity Trading Operations focuses on executing and managing trades efficiently, Commodity Trading Analysts analyze market trends to inform trading decisions. Both roles are essential in the trading process but differ in focus and responsibilities.
